                • justintempler
                  Member
                  • Nov 2008
                  • 3090

                  #23
                  lössnus is a better value.
                  I use the same amount of snus potions or lös

                  A roll of LD portions, 240 grams total, $25.00
                  A roll of LD lössnus, 450 grams total, $24.02
